> > > is there any way (and if yes: how?) to convince kaffeine to connect to |
7 |
> > > jack? |
8 |
> > > |
9 |
> > > Thank you very much in advance for any help! |
10 |
> > > Best regards, |
11 |
> > > mcc |
12 |
> > |
13 |
> > kaffeine uses xine. You can configure it in |
14 |
> > ~/.kde4/share/apps/kaffeine/xine-config |
15 |
> > |
16 |
> > Setting "audio.driver:jack" /should/ work. |
